Natalie Blake (born 4 December 1982) is a British powerlifter.[1] She competed for England in the women's 61 kg event at the 2014 Commonwealth Games[2] where she won a silver medal.[3] She also competed at the 2018 Commonwealth Games where she came 6th in the lightweight event.[4]
